Output 5f100b3c123106a964cffb77817d1d50eb86de09edf932f45253a8230e7ed7ff:21

value
186331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6620bad4ba68fe41ebabaa57ad5cc32f8b69da8b OP_EQUAL
address
3B124DZeMenbQH3ywaXJsihifJuAsZSVkx
transaction
5f100b3c123106a964cffb77817d1d50eb86de09edf932f45253a8230e7ed7ff
spent
true